Protecting synthetic chlorinated swimming pools demands typical checking of chlorine amounts and drinking water good qu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to Test the chlorine focus regularly to be sure it stays throughout the proposed variety. Far too little chlorine can lead to insufficient sanitation, allowing for bacteria and algae to thrive. However, too much chlorine concentrations might cause skin and eye irritation for swimmers. The best chlorine stage for synthetic chlorinated swimming pools ordinarily falls between 1 and three parts for each million (ppm). Protecting this equilibrium is important for providing a comfortable and Secure swimming practical experience.

In combination with chlorine levels, synthetic chlorinated pools have to have proper pH stability. The pH of pool water need to ideally be concerning 7.two and 7.six. If the pH is simply too small, the drinking water results in being acidic, bringing about corrosion of pool devices and irritation for swimmers. When the pH is too significant, chlorine results in being much less helpful, minimizing its ability to sanitize the water. Common tests and adjustment of pH ranges assistance be certain that synthetic chlorinated swimming pools continue being well-balanced and comfortable for consumers. Pool homeowners often use pH tests kits and chemical changes to keep up the correct pH amounts within their pools.

Yet another critical aspect of synthetic chlorinated swimming pools is the usage of st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ade swiftly when subjected to daylight, minimizing its efficiency like a disinfectant. To fight this, pool entrepreneurs normally incorporate c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that helps extend the lifetime of chlorine in outdoor swimming pools. With no stabilizers, chlorine ranges can fall rapidly, necessitating Recurrent additions to maintain right sanitation. By utilizing the appropriate quantity of stabilizer, artificial chlorinated swimming pools can keep on being cleaner for for a longer time durations with negligible chlorine loss.

Artificial chlorinated pools also call for plan maintenance past chemical balancing. Filtration programs Participate in an important role in maintaining the water thoroughly clean by eliminating debris, dirt, and natural make a difference. Pool filters, like s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, support lure impurities and prevent them from circulating in the h2o. Standard cleaning and backwashing of filters be certain they purpose successfully. Furthermore, pool proprietors should skim the drinking water area, vacuum the pool floor, and brush the pool partitions to prevent algae buildup and manage water clarity. Right upkeep can help synthetic chlorinated pools stay in exceptional situation for swimmers.

Lately, There's been an increased concentrate on eco-welcoming methods for artificial chlorinated swimming pools. Some pool house owners and operators are Discovering methods to cut down chemical usage while protecting water quality. Just one substitute is using ozone or ultraviolet (UV) light units, which perform together with chlorine to enhance disinfection and lessen the level of chemical substances wanted. These systems support stop working contaminants and cut down chlorine byproducts, producing the drinking water gentler to the pores and skin and eyes. On top of that, developments in filtration know-how have enhanced the effectiveness of water circulation and purification, contributing to cleaner and even more sustainable pool upkeep procedures.
